The dealer and Dodge Ram reprehensive would not cover the cost of having both liners replaced. The Liners were rubbing on the tires and allowed mud, snow and ice to get up into my front bumper and knock out my fog lights and damage the wiring to my fog lights. Quality of Liners and there installation was piss poor. Liner were made out of plastic and the plastic was so thin that snow and ice beat them out the lack of proper mounting points also caused them to fold up. The new liners were installed with a metal trim and large fender washers that were placed properly around the liners. this is the second Ram and I will never buy another one.
Quality was bad and company and dealer would not stand behind the product.
